Main Content

Counter

離散時間または連続時間のカウンター

  • Counter block

ライブラリ:
Simscape / Electrical / Control / General Control

説明

Counter ブロックは、離散時間または連続時間のインクリメンタル カウンターを実装します。カウンターは次のいずれかの条件に対応してインクリメントします。

  • 上 — 入力が上昇する。

  • 下 — 入力が下降する。

  • 上-下 — 入力が上昇または下降する。

端子

出力

すべて展開する

カウンターの値。

データ型: single | double

パラメーター

すべて展開する

カウンター タイプ。

出力の範囲。

タイマー周期 (秒)。

位相遅延 (秒)。位相遅延を追加してカウンターの初期状態を変更します。

連続するブロック実行間の時間間隔。実行時に、ブロックは出力を生成し、必要に応じて内部状態を更新します。詳細については、サンプル時間とはサンプル時間の指定を参照してください。

離散時間シミュレーションについては、サンプル時間を正のスカラーに設定します。連続時間シミュレーションについては、サンプル時間を 0 に設定します。

拡張機能

C/C++ コード生成
Simulink® Coder™ を使用して C および C++ コードを生成します。

バージョン履歴

R2018b で導入